Transaction 32417091891fb779c702e894a279d3f7a4ebc428dddc2f590773fbbe9aa24e21
1 Input
1 Output
-
32417091891fb779c702e894a279d3f7a4ebc428dddc2f590773fbbe9aa24e21:0
- value
- 2330000
- script pubkey
- OP_0 OP_PUSHBYTES_20 cff3db961e2a779194122e7d0856f94b53018dd2
- address
- bc1qeleah9s79fmer9qj9e7ss4hefdfsrrwjqjqa0v